Strong's #4735: stephanos (pronounced stef'-an-os)

from an apparently primary stepho (to twine or wreathe); a chaplet (as a badge of royalty, a prize in the public games or a symbol of honor generally; but more conspicuous and elaborate than the simple fillet, 1238), literally or figuratively:--crown.




Thayer's Greek Lexicon:

́

stephanos

1) a crown

1a) a mark of royal or (in general) exalted rank

1a1) the wreath or garland which was given as a prize to victors in public games

1b) metaphorically the eternal blessedness which will be given as aprize to the genuine servants of God and Christ: the crown (wreath) which is the reward of the righteousness

1c) that which is an ornament and honour to one

Part of Speech: noun masculine

Relation: from an apparently primary stepho (to twine or wreathe)

Citing in TDNT: 7:615, 1078




Usage:

This word is used 18 times:

Matthew 27:29: "And when they had plaited a crown of thorns, they put it upon his"
Mark 15:17: "they clothed him with purple, and plaited a crown of thorns, and put it about his"
John 19:2: "the soldiers plaited a crown of thorns, and put it on his"
John 19:5: "forth, wearing the crown of thorns, and the purple"
1 Corinthians 9:25: "to obtain a corruptible crown; but we an incorruptible."
Philippians 4:1: "my joy and crown, so stand fast in the Lord,"
1 Thessalonians 2:19: "or joy, or crown of rejoicing? Are not even"
2 Timothy 4:8: "Henceforth there is laid up for me a crown of righteousness, which the Lord,"
James 1:12: "tried, he shall receive the crown of life, which the Lord"
1 Peter 5:4: "chief Shepherd shall appear, ye shall receive a crown of glory that fadeth not away."
Revelation 2:10: "and I will give thee a crown of life."
Revelation 3:11: "no man take thy crown."
Revelation 4:4: "white raiment; and they had on their heads crowns"
Revelation 4:10: "him that liveth forever and ever, and cast their crowns"
Revelation 6:2: "had a bow; and a crown was given unto him: and he went forth"
Revelation 9:7: "their heads were as it were crowns like gold, and their"
Revelation 12:1: "upon her head a crown of twelve stars:"
Revelation 14:14: "his head a golden crown, and in his hand"
